SECTION 11. WELL LOCATION AND COMPLETION/PLUGGINGRULE 11.1 RESPONSIBILITY (a) After a Water Well Registration or Application for Temporary Water Well Permit has been issued, the well, if drilled, must be drilled within 30 feet of the location specified on the registration or permit, not closer to property lines or existing wells that would cause the well location to be in violation of Rules 8.1 and/or 8.2, and not elsewhere. (b) If a permit was issued under the provisions of Rule 9.2(b)(2)(B), Rule 11.1(a) does not apply except that the person to whom the permit was issued shall clearly mark the location of the well on the permit issued for that site and provide accurate measurements, in feet, to the two closest non-parallel property lines and to existing wells on the property. RULE 11.2 COMPLETION/PLUGGING OF WELLS (a) All water wells drilled within the District shall be completed or plugged in accordance with the Administrative Rules of the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ation, Texas Administrative Code, Chapter 76, Water Well Drillers and Pump Installers. (b) A violation of the Administrative Rules of the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ation, Texas Administrative Code, Chapter 76, Water Well Drillers and Pump Installers shall be considered a violation of District Rules and disposition of such violations shall be in accordance with Section 17 of the District rules. (c) To aid the implementation of 76.1001 Water Well Drillers and Pump Installers Rules, the following procedure shall be used when drilling through formations underlying the Ogallala: (1) A water sample from the Ogallala portion of the boring shall be submitted to the District Office for analysis of total salts. (2) A water sample from any of the underlying formations shall likewise be submitted to the District office for analysis of total salts. |
